Output 05efb96b05018e2e59ac1cc01d18371b1529491ac05b33416e156452fa0f6e97:0

value
699965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944fe48209e5ceb013aa2fa11c77a5902bfb8d9a OP_EQUAL
address
3FDDdyEtMkZgynKLWZT9FsVVeuoG8Y6CWz
transaction
05efb96b05018e2e59ac1cc01d18371b1529491ac05b33416e156452fa0f6e97
spent
true